Study “Injection Charges” published
The Netherlands are planning to introduce injection charges in order to pass on some of the costs of offshore grid connections to other countries. In a joint study with Neon Neue Energieökonomik on behalf of TenneT, we investigate whether this can be achieved. Our results show that unilateral injection charges - i.e. without European coordination – will likely lead to market distortions. Selective charges for offshore wind are only suitable for refinancing the associated grid costs only under specific conditions.
